OK, here we go... I found the folder from our Thanksgiving trip & here's the scoop.

We were there from Friday, Nov. 16th - Sunday, Nov. 25th (Thanksgiving Day was the 22nd). The park hours were as follows:

Magic Kingdom:

(Sun, Mon, Tues, Wed, Sat): 9:00am-12am
(Thursday, Friday): 8:00am-12am

EMHs were Morning, Thursday (Thanksgiving) & Evening, Sunday the 18th

EPCOT:
Future World (all days): 9:00am-7pm

World Showcase:
(Sun, Mon, Tues, Wed, Thurs): 11:00am-9pm
(Fri, Sat): 11:00-9:30pm

EMHs were Moring, Tuesday the 20th & Evening, Friday the 23rd

MGM:
All Days: 9:00am-8pm
EMHs: Morning, Saturday the 24th & Evening, Mon. the 19th

Animal Kingdom:
All Days: 8:00am-8:00pm
EMHs: Morning, Monday the 19th & Evening, Wednesday the 21st

My take on the week as far as crowds go was that it was LITERALLY a week split in two. From the Sunday BEFORE Thanksgiving until Wed., it was fairly "average" park attendance. We hardly used any fast passes, at the end of the night & during the mid-day rush the bus areas were pretty sparce, plenty of space to watch parades & fireworks, quick service lunch locations were short waits & tables easy to find.

On Thanksgiving morning I was SHOCKED how empty the park was. We arrived to the MK at opening for extra magic hours, & LITERALLY the park was near empty until around 10:00 am. At that point it seemed like all of Central Florida poured into into the MK. "Wall to wall" from about 11am-4pm. To us it made NO difference AT ALL b/c we got there SUPER early & were ready to move onto other things after our 12 noon meal at Liberty Tree, by the time the crowds got bad. It hardly effected us at all.

After Thanksgiving dinner at 1900 Park Fare we decided to walk around DtD... EMPTY!

"Black Friday," which is the day after Thanksgiving was WEIRD! This is the 2nd year in a row we've been in the parks for Black Friday & to be honest once AGAIN we were surprised how slow the parks seemed. We were in EPCOT & MGM and honestly we didn't have any crowd problems at all. UNTIL... we tried to go see the Osborne Lights!!! DO YOURSELF A FAVOR... DO OSBOURNE LIGHTS BEFORE THANKSGIVING DAY!!! I am telling you that all of WDW was poured into that backlot every night AFTER Thanksgiving. Before Thanksgiving we walked down the street & took pictures with ease, AFTER Thanksgiving it was elbow to elbow.

The only other advice I could give would be the whole ADR thing, people don't play when it comes to having ADRs on Thanksgiving Day, both lunch & dinner. We LITERALLY called when the line opened 180 days before Thanksgiving & we were only able to get Liberty Tree for lunch & two days later the ONLY dinner locations left were 1900 Park Fare, Morocco, & Norway. It was CRAZY!

It was a great week to go though. The temps were nice, no rain, light crowds BEFORE Thanksgiving, you get to see all the holiday decor, etc. We loved it!

1) Accourding to the "WDW Times Guide & New Information" thingy I saved "SpectroMagic" was at 8pm & 10pm every night. Wishes was at 9:00pm.

2) Fantasmic was listed for 6:30 & 8pm

3) On Thanksgiving morning the MK opened for "Extra Magic Hours" at 7am.
